Exemple : Définition des valeurs par défaut pour les propriétés

Vous pouvez définir une valeur par défaut pour la plupart des propriétés d'objet via un gestionnaire d'événement Initialize.

  1. Ajoutez la métaclasse appropriée dans votre profil (voir Métaclasses (Profile)), et créez un gestionnaire d'événement de type Initialize sous elle.
  2. Cliquez sur l'onglet Script du gestionnaire d'événement et modifiez le script afin de spécifier les valeur par défaut pour une ou plusieurs des propriétés du formulaire :
     obj.NomPropriété = Valeur
    Par exemple, le script suivant définit le stéréotype d'un héritage de MCD a MonHeritage et sa propriété Générer les enfants a la valeur N'hériter que les attributs primaires :
    Function %Initialize%(obj)
        obj.Stereotype = "MonHeritage"
        obj.InheritAll = False
        %Initialize% = True
    End Function
  3. Cliquez sur OK pour enregistrer vos modifications et refermer l'éditeur de ressources.
    Dorénavant, lorsque vous créerez un héritage dans votre modèle, ces propriétés seront définies avec les valeurs par défaut.